10 Survival Survival would be the theme for the beginning because Phillip’s family and him have to live through the war. Everyday the war is going on and he could get shot by a soldier or get hurt. One of his family members could get shot especially his dad because he goes to work everyday. He had to survive from the boat being torpedoed he could’ve died from falling in the water and hitting his head if Timothy didn’t get him onto the raft. They also need to survive on the raft because if they just sat there they would probably die. They needed to catch fish and reserve lots of water and not look into the sun. If I was on that raft I would really want to go in the water but I would want to survive.

11 Survival is in the middle of the book to. They have been on the raft for several weeks and they have to preserve water and if they don’t they would probably die on the raft. Also they have to stay out of the water or they will probably get eaten by sharks. One time Phillip fell into the water and felt something hit his leg. That’s an example of surviving. Also on the island they have to find shelter and its especially hard for Phillip because he’s blind. When Timothy leaves him he has to survive on his own for probably an hour or half and hour. There isn’t much food on the island either so they have to take little portions of their food they have.

12 Survival is end to. Its in the end because they have to prepare for the hurricane. They tie things to a high palm tree so they don’t get washed away. The have to eat a big feast because the fish won’t be back for awhile. During the storm they have to survive it by tying themselves to a tree. Timothy protects Phillip and timothy ends up dying because he was so tired. After the storm Phillip has to reestablish his camp like rebuilding his hut, getting food, finding the fishing poles, and making the signal fire. This is all a struggle because Phillip is blind. So this is going to be hard for him to survive.

14 In the middle of the book Phillip is still stubborn and adventurous. He is stubborn when he is arguing that they shouldn’t go onto the island. He says they should just keep going and wait to get rescued on the raft. Also when Phillip doesn’t let Timothy go away because he is scared that someone or something will come and get him. So he yells for Timothy and doesn’t let him go away. But later he feels more save on the island and he is ok with it. Phillip is also adventurous. On the raft Timothy said there was land and Phillip freaked out and said where and fell into the water. Also on the island he started to learn walk around and he learned where he was. If he wasn’t so adventurous he wouldn’t have learned the island as well as he did. One day he decided he wanted to climb the cocoanut tree. He succeeded and got the cocoanut.

15 At the End of the book Phillip is kind of stubborn and adventurous. Phillip has grown from his stubbornness. He has learned so much from Timothy and understands things now. He is stubborn in a way where he doesn’t want to hang out with kids his age anymore because he thinks they are to young. He then spends most of his time going to school and talking with the black people who knew Timothy. His stubbornness would be part of becoming more mature and this shows that being on that island made Phillip become mature. He is also adventurous at the end. On the island he decides to do something Timothy never told him to do. He decides to jump into the hole and get a langosta for him to eat. This shows he is adventurous because Timothy told him never to do this. He was tired of eating fish and wanted a langosta. He got one but something bit his hand. It wouldn’t let go and he got teeth marks and blood all over him. He decided he never wanted to go in that hole again.
